The SWM logo represents the SWM Motors, an Italian automotive brand. Its main vehicle series include the SWM X7, SWM X3, and SWM G01, with a total of 31 models under these three lineups. SWM Motors has established R&D and design centers in both Chongqing, China, and Milan, Italy, forming an independent development system in areas such as vehicle design, engine development, and performance matching. Key milestones in SWM Motors' development are as follows: In the 1970s and 1980s, SWM participated in various competitions including Italian Regular Races, European Regular Races, FMI Cup Regular Races, and the American Six Days Race, achieving excellent results and becoming one of Europe's top three off-road brands. In 2016, SWM Motors launched its first model, the 'SWM X7', in Chongqing. By the end of 2017, SWM Motors recruited Cosimo, Toyota Europe's chief designer and Audi's chief exterior designer, as the Design Director of the European Styling Design Center, responsible for styling design-related tasks. In 2020, the SWM X7 Champion Edition was officially launched. In 2020, the SWM X2 model was officially released, comprising two variants.

While researching automotive brand histories, I discovered that the SWM logo represents this car manufacturer. Originating in Italy in 1971, it was initially the Speedy Working Motors motorcycle brand before going bankrupt during the 1980s economic crisis. It wasn't until 2014 that China's Dongfang XinYuan Group acquired and revitalized it as an automotive brand, focusing on SUVs and pickup trucks. Currently, SWM produces a range of models for the Chinese market, such as the SWM G01 compact SUV and G05 midsize SUV, known for their affordable prices ranging from 100,000 to 200,000 yuan, making them ideal family vehicles. These cars offer spacious interiors and rich configurations, including automatic air conditioning and large touchscreen infotainment systems, though the abundant use of plastic interior materials gives a slightly budget feel. SWM's designs incorporate European styling elements, with comfortably tuned suspensions for stable driving. Despite being an emerging brand, its high cost-performance ratio has gained popularity in urban and rural areas. If you prioritize practicality without breaking the bank, SWM is worth considering.

As an automotive enthusiast, I frequently keep an eye on emerging market players. The SWM logo belongs to the SWM brand, which is currently operated by Chinese capital and produces SUV series models. Core products include the G01 and G07 SUVs, both emphasizing sporty aesthetics and affordability. The G01 is an entry-level compact SUV with a starting price of around 100,000 yuan, equipped with a 1.5T turbocharged engine that delivers smooth power output, making it suitable for daily commuting. The G07 offers more space, catering to larger families, and also provides an electric version to meet green license plate requirements. SWM prioritizes safety in its configurations, featuring ABS and ESP, though the electronic systems can sometimes be slightly slow to respond. Positioned in the mid-to-low-end segment of the Chinese market, SWM's pricing is lower than brands like Toyota or Honda, appealing to budget-conscious consumers. The brand also focuses on expanding its after-sales service network, with service points covering third- and fourth-tier cities to make maintenance more convenient. Overall, SWM is a cost-effective choice, particularly for first-time car owners seeking hassle-free and economical options.

How Long Is the Warranty Period for Windshield Wipers?

Windshield wipers come with a warranty period of 6 months or 10,000 kilometers, as they are considered wear-and-tear items with a relatively short warranty duration. Generally, it is recommended to inspect windshield wipers every six months and replace them approximately once a year. Below is some relevant information: 1. Windshield Wipers: Windshield wipers are made of plastic. Parking your car in a shaded area can help extend their lifespan. High-quality windshield wipers should be heat-resistant, cold-resistant, acid and alkali-resistant, corrosion-resistant, able to fit the windshield properly, reduce the burden on the motor, produce low noise, have strong water-repellent properties, and be soft enough not to scratch the windshield, ensuring clear visibility. 2. Types of Windshield Wipers: There are roughly two types of windshield wipers. One is the traditional intermittent type, which is the most common and has three to four adjustable settings, allowing the driver to adjust based on rain intensity and visibility. The other type is the rain-sensing wiper, which is mostly used in mid-to-high-end vehicle models.

How to Obtain a C1D Driver's License?

C1D is a combined driver's license for motor vehicles and motorcycles, which adds the motorcycle driving category to the existing motor vehicle driver's license. The C1D driver's license cannot be obtained directly. You must first pass the C1 driver's license test and then apply for the additional D license. To apply for the additional D license, you must have held the C1 driver's license for at least one year and have no record of accumulating 12 or more penalty points in the current scoring cycle or the most recent scoring cycle before application. Driver's License Classification: Motor vehicle driver's licenses are divided into 16 categories: A1, A2, A3, B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, C5, D, E, F, M, N, and P. C1 Driver's License: The C1 driver's license is one of the motor vehicle driver's license codes. The C1 driver's license allows driving small and mini passenger vehicles, light and mini cargo vehicles; light, small, and mini special-purpose vehicles; and small passenger vehicles with a seating capacity of 9 or fewer people.

Where is the cabin air filter located in the BMW X1?

The cabin air filter in the BMW X1 is located under the wipers in the engine compartment. The functions of the cabin air filter are: 1. To filter the air entering the cabin from the outside, improving air cleanliness; 2. To provide a comfortable environment for passengers and protect their health. The BMW X1 is a compact 5-door, 5-seat SUV with body dimensions of: length 4565mm, width 1821mm, height 1620mm, and a wheelbase of 2780mm. The BMW X1 is equipped with a 1.5T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um power of 103 kW and a maximum torque of 220 Nm.
